The Obama Dilemma: “Change” or Prosperity?

Little understood by those in the media (anyone surprised?) is what could cause the current credit blow-off and associated recession to devolve into a full blown depression. To understand, one has to take a brief trip down “Globalization Lane.” “Globalization” is a a term generically used to describe the opening up of product and financial […]